HK not yet out of protest ‘dilemma’: Chinese Premier



HONG KONG: Chinese Premier Li Keqiang on Monday met with Hong Kong leader Carrie Lam in Beijing and discussed the crisis in Hong Kong.

He said that Hong Kong was not yet out of the ‘dilemma’, international media reports have said.

Lam is also due to hold a pivotal meeting with President Xi Jinping soon.

Lam’s meeting with Li comes after Hong Kong police fired several rounds of tear gas at anti-government protesters on Sunday.

During the meeting, Premier Li said that SAR (Special Administrative Region) government needs to continue its efforts to end violence and stop the chaos to restore law and order in Hong Kong. (Agencies)
